What size is an Er20 collet?
ER Collet
Length
Clamping Range
ER-20
31.5 mm (1.24")
1—13 mm (0.039—0.512")
ER-25
34 mm (1.34")
1—16 mm (0.039—0.630")
ER-32
40 mm (1.57"
1—21 mm (0.039—0.827")
ER-40
46 mm (1.81")
3—26 mm (0.118—1.024")
What does er stand for in collets?
The standard series are: ER-8, ER-11, ER-16, ER-20, ER-25, ER-32, ER-40, and ER-50. The "ER" name came from an existing "E" collet (which were a letter series of names) which Rego-Fix modified and appended "R" for "Rego-Fix". The series number is the opening diameter of the tapered receptacle, in millimetres.
How to identify collet type?
The easiest way to determine what type of collet your machine has is to measure the length and diameter of the collet. All collets have a distinctive length and diameter.
What size collet should I use?
Your first consideration should be the size of end mills or drills you will be using most often. If you are doing smaller work you would require smaller diameter range collets. Generally you may prefer the ER16 and ER32 sizes. ​If you are doing very small work then perhaps an ER11 set would be the best choice.
